Top Locations Tagged with Computer products in central qld

Computer products in central qld in Australia - 4711/ near glendale/Computer-products near central-qld

Computer products in central qld in Australia - 4740/ near andergrove/Computer-products near central-qld

Computer products in central qld in Australia - 4802/ near central-qld

Computer products in central qld in Australia - / near central-qld